{ "$schema": "internal://schemas/plugin.lock.v1.json", "pluginId": "gh:NTCoding/claude-skillz:development-skills", "normalized": { "repo": null, "ref": "refs/tags/v20251128.0", "commit": "71c20c6ea2998815fb39b865ed68f49137c4f48d", "treeHash": "61342949408b864d291b3bffea03339e7abda9732ec73b6f9c982b778cad17b5", "generatedAt": "2025-11-28T10:12:09.221026Z", "toolVersion": "publish_plugins.py@0.2.0" }, "origin": { "remote": "git@github.com:zhongweili/42plugin-data.git", "branch": "master", "commit": "aa1497ed0949fd50e99e70d6324a29c5b34f9390", "repoRoot": "/Users/zhongweili/projects/openmind/42plugin-data" }, "manifest": { "name": "development-skills", "description": "Random skills for various software development tasks" }, "content": { "files": [ { "path": "README.md", "sha256": "7603e12b691ba765b5e96dfcd2374fd776e5fac2b9954583c1b7a09e2b7da70e" }, { "path": ".claude-plugin/plugin.json", "sha256": "c9d31771555b6b2a2d393aeb4cf8cf36d78a380bdd86e7942dc92cbe1dc20ebd" }, { "path": "skills/concise-output/SKILL.md", "sha256": "c9f5f934f8c902e9cebbdf23959830e93b50f6da1a821ab5bddadff9013faeb1" }, { "path": "skills/observability-first-debugging/SKILL.md", "sha256": "0513718202faff91a203f27924ffcd8131feb79d29d73670c7a00d5902905b34" }, { "path": "skills/independent-research/SKILL.md", "sha256": "06bfbdcbf8ae4d8d9c2370d71c2e423bf0f8ddbf71d64a4a8fcfbcde8352b8f0" }, { "path": "skills/data-visualization/SKILL.md", "sha256": "ab4a65673e3aa1d602618c7abaa30e5b56e486d469b1b1e96f21ede7d771593b" }, { "path": "skills/software-design-principles/README.md", "sha256": "c8ef561d5d3074dedf8cf083c3ede282fbca124865d007704d05d28b35a0c648" }, { "path": "skills/software-design-principles/SKILL.md", "sha256": "58ffa4bb0b69cf91aaf3fba69dda95ed3e0aa2e96bb6e501d167a4821765a3eb" }, { "path": "skills/critical-peer-personality/README.md", "sha256": "5d7ea4cfc14797cd072f3d4a45ff87b36726195badfbb26f8359bf0b657173e6" }, { "path": "skills/critical-peer-personality/SKILL.md", "sha256": "cbf1e9f8d3458d7c08367b646edc3a9b33b66d299323552d44292b7c7dcd9548" }, { "path": "skills/lightweight-design-analysis/README.md", "sha256": "a8100f607822535f9d10e3c7d82ca58825f4ed57a00b978412bbfedef8c81987" }, { "path": "skills/lightweight-design-analysis/SKILL.md", "sha256": "50fc6b84f4347922868a4b448b54f80fbdcd3e9a474a7fbd823a7cc9ba94feb8" }, { "path": "skills/lightweight-task-workflow/README.md", "sha256": "269b53e11c322fdea6e7f2bd86e93ea01585970ced90050b952a709a69bba75b" }, { "path": "skills/lightweight-task-workflow/SKILL.md", "sha256": "918189aae480cc9fc452eca5014202245b6528481f612e8b111d75df1e9f119e" }, { "path": "skills/tdd-process/README.md", "sha256": "da1391bba11a3903ae7dcdda04571b8b79f8c394ba78ad27af8c14ed9a56fa7d" }, { "path": "skills/tdd-process/SKILL.md", "sha256": "4a6d9088ab1a26f1145b4a262c582ae349a524a76cbfe8c23b39b170bb63cc74" }, { "path": "skills/writing-tests/SKILL.md", "sha256": "62a2ca76bc156b331e53ce653c2fa41a755656e1e602dfaaae382c889aa9a9cc" }, { "path": "skills/lightweight-implementation-analysis-protocol/README.md", "sha256": "f3e6f1c753c36b0d0de7301d1b2869f44884a63c79348ef93836e23645f68a4a" }, { "path": "skills/lightweight-implementation-analysis-protocol/SKILL.md", "sha256": "1cc09d75c71bb8f1a6ce9ef3af54b23bcec7ef4bc0c880cd2ae085c68df2cf96" }, { "path": "skills/switch-persona/README.md", "sha256": "951a53a2155061ebe8962a229da56c613775de4f100c01f3a6998560893ae5a6" }, { "path": "skills/switch-persona/SKILL.md", "sha256": "8046a1a2d2b57516589592f93cb3e72be83c5541fe14ca585caadffcf5d83be4" } ], "dirSha256": "61342949408b864d291b3bffea03339e7abda9732ec73b6f9c982b778cad17b5" }, "security": { "scannedAt": null, "scannerVersion": null, "flags": [] } }